NetBrain is ranked 5th in Network Automation with 6 reviews while SolarWinds Network Automation Manager is ranked 13th in Network Automation. NetBrain is rated 7.2, while SolarWinds Network Automation Manager is rated 5.6. The top reviewer of NetBrain writes "Good monitoring and troubleshoot capabilities, improves overall network traffic visibility". On the other hand, the top reviewer of SolarWinds Network Automation Manager writes "Threat detection failures, poor technical support, and expensive".
